Next.js 16 App Router Best Practices
Comprehensive Next.js 16 App Router guide for AI agents. Contains 45 rules across 9 categories, prioritized by impact from critical (build optimization, caching strategy) through to cross-cutting codebase hygiene (dedup, dead routes, boundary coherence). Reflects Next.js 16 changes: 'use cache' directive replacing implicit caching, revalidateTag(tag, cacheLife) requirement, proxy.ts replacing middleware.ts, Turbopack persistent caching, App Router conventions.
Rule files describe pattern shapes (not API names) and open with a "Shapes to recognize" section listing 2–4 syntactic disguises the same break can wear. Selected high-value rules (those whose disguises are most common in practice — 'use cache', parallel-fetching, dynamic-imports, server-action-forms, client-boundary, server-vs-client-fetching) include an extra concrete "In disguise" incorrect/correct example pair to teach pattern detection beyond the grep-friendly cases.

How to Review or Refactor a Codebase
When the user asks to review, refactor, modernize, or audit Next.js code — single file or whole repo — follow [references/_review-algorithm.md](references/_review-algorithm.md). Do not improvise.
Four non-negotiables from that doc:
- Two modes — never refuse a whole-repo audit. Pick Mode A (scoped, ≤~20 files) or Mode B (whole-tree: inventory pass + targeted sweeps + full Category 9).
- Judgment over grep. Each rule names a pattern shape, not a syntactic marker. Read each rule's Shapes to recognize section before sweeping — grep finds the easy violations and misses the high-value ones (a layout marked
'use client'for one button; TanStack Query fetching initial page data; a route handler doing the work of a Server Action; a hand-rolled cache layer mimicking'use cache'; sequential fetches hidden across parent/child Server Components). - Category-major, not file-major — with forcing functions. Sweep one category at a time across all in-scope files in priority order (CRITICAL → … → CROSS-CUTTING). The algorithm requires a scope declaration, per-category progress lines, and a final coverage table (category × file/bucket, cells ∈
{clean, N findings, n/a}). A missing category in the output is immediately visible. - Codebase-level findings come from Category 9. Single-file rules can't tell you "these two routes should be one" or "this server action is dead." Category 9 (Codebase Hygiene) sweeps the full inventory at the end and produces remove / dedup / reuse / consolidate findings.
Single-file ad-hoc questions ("is this caching strategy right?") can go straight to the relevant rule. The algorithm exists for the multi-file and whole-repo cases.

Next.js 16 idioms (do NOT generate Next.js 15 patterns):
proxy.ts(Node runtime) — notmiddleware.ts(Edge)- Explicit
'use cache'— not implicit fetch caching revalidateTag(tag, cacheLife)— not single-argrevalidateTag(tag)- Server Action +
useActionState— not clientfetch+useState app/sitemap.ts— not hand-maintainedpublic/sitemap.xml
Common single-file mistakes — avoid these anti-patterns:
- Sequential
awaitfor independent data (usePromise.allor preload) useEffect+fetchin a Client Component for initial page data'use client'at the layout level for one interactive button- Missing
revalidatePath/revalidateTagafter a mutating Server Action - Skeletons that don't match content dimensions (CLS hit)
Codebase-level patterns — surface these in Category 9 sweeps:
- 2+ Server Components hitting the same upstream with drifting cache policies — extract to a shared cached fetcher
- 2+ near-duplicate routes/layouts that should be one with a variant or dynamic segment — consolidate
- Routes / route handlers / Server Actions with no inbound traffic for 90+ days — delete (after analytics check)
'use client'propagating up the route tree because of one interactive leaf — demote layouts/parents to Server Components, leave a client island- Same concept under different route-param/search-param/prop names — converge on a canonical name (watch out for SEO redirects)
